Use a slide, but with your picking hand - apply some pressure and slide up and down the strings. Makes some cool glisses... also, try holding the slide between the p'ups and the bridge, and pick/finger between...
There's also Tony Levin's "Funk Fingers."drumstick whacking the strings. does that count?
I like to set the strings(right between the nut & first fret)against the edge of a speaker cab & use it as a howling-w/feedback slide.
I've been thinking about purchasing some funk fingers, although there seems to be a lot of hate out there regarding them.There's also Tony Levin's "Funk Fingers."
Basically drumsticks attached to his fingers for playing a mutant slap-bass style with.
slides are always cool. Sometimes I use an allen wrench for a slide. Using a quarter for a pick makes pick slides easy.
